The chiral Zn(Il)-Na(I) coordination polymer with formula [NaZn(acac)(2)(AcO)(EtOH)] (1) has been synthesized, and characterized by H-1 NMR and FT-IR spectra, elemental, X-ray, and thermogravimetric analysis (TGA). X-ray crystallographic study revealed that I crystallizes in the non -centrosymmetric space groups P2(1)2(1)2(1) and exhibits a one-dimensional polymer chain. Linear optical properties were investigated by UV/Vis spectrophotometer techniques. Kurtz-Perry powder second-harmonic-generation (SHG) test confirms the non-linear optical (NLO) property of the grown crystal. (c) 2008 Elsevier B.V. All rights reserved.
